Academic Staff

Sotirios A. Tsaftaris

Chair in Machine Learning and Computer Vision

Sotirios A. Tsaftaris is currently Chair (Full Professor) in Machine Learning and Computer Vision at the University of Edinburgh. He also holds the Canon Medical/Royal Academy of Engineering Research Chair in Healthcare AI.
He is the Director for the EPSRC-funded AI Hub for Causality in Healthcare AI with Real Data (CHAI). He is an ELLIS Fellow of the European Lab for Learning and Intelligent Systems (ELLIS) of Edinburgh’s ELLIS Unit. Since 2023 he is a visiting researcher with Archimedes RC a research centre of excellence in AI in Athens, Greece. Between 2016 and 2023 he was a Turing Fellow with the Alan Turing Institute.

Jingshuai Liu

Post-doctoral Researcher

Jingshuai Liu received the bachelor’s degree in electronic science and technology from Tianjin University, China, in 2016, and the master’s degree in signal processing and communications in 2018 from The University of Edinburgh, UK, where he received the Ph.D. degree in 2023. His research project is Compressive MRI with Deep Convolutional and Attentive Models, which concerns the incorporation of neural network models and deep learning-based methods in fast MRI reconstruction to achieve high image quality from sparsely sampled signals. During his study, Jingshuai Liu gained background knowledge in image processing, medical imaging, deep learning and neural network models, and developed independent and collaborative research ability and communication skills. His research interests include image processing, machining learning, medical imaging, and computer vision.
